- In this work we study the main differences between the superconducting properties of the Bi$\text{}_{4}$Sr$\text{}_{3}$Ca$\text{}_{3}$Cu$\text{}_{4}$O$\text{}_{x}$ and (Bi$\text{}_{0.8}$Pb$\text{}_{0.2}$)$\text{}_{4}$Sr$\text{}_{3}$Ca$\text{}_{3}$Cu$\text{}_{4}$O$\text{}_{x}$ glass-ceramics. The Bi$\text{}_{4}$Sr$\text{}_{3}$Ca$\text{}_{3}$Cu$\text{}_{4}$O$\text{}_{x}$ and (Bi$\text{}_{0.8}$Pb$\text{}_{0.2}$)$\text{}_{4}$Sr$\text{}_{3}$Ca$\text{}_{3}$Cu$\text{}_{4}$O$\text{}_{x}$ glass-ceramics prepared in the same conditions contain similar amounts of the superconducting 2212 phase, however their superconducting and normal-state electrical properties differ significantly. The main reason which makes BiSrCaCuO glass-ceramics worse superconductor than BiPbSrCaCuO is its microstructure.
